The Silent Cry of Longing: Analyzing 'Tu Ca Nun Chiagne' by Enrico Caruso

Enrico Caruso's 'Tu Ca Nun Chiagne' is a poignant Neapolitan song that delves deep into themes of longing, solitude, and unrequited love. The song's title translates to 'You Who Do Not Cry,' setting the stage for a narrative filled with emotional depth and introspection. Caruso, a legendary tenor known for his powerful voice and emotive delivery, brings these themes to life with a hauntingly beautiful performance.

The lyrics paint a vivid picture of a serene night, with the mountain appearing more beautiful and calm than ever before. This tranquil setting contrasts sharply with the singer's inner turmoil. The mountain, described as a tired and resigned soul under the white moonlight, serves as a metaphor for the singer's own weary heart. Despite the peaceful surroundings, the singer is kept awake by thoughts of a loved one who remains distant and unresponsive. The repeated refrain, 'Tu ca nun chiagne e chiágnere mme faje,' underscores the paradox of the loved one's indifference causing the singer's tears.

Caruso's plea, 'Voglio a te! Voglio a te!' (I want you! I want you!), is a raw expression of his desire to see the loved one again. The eyes that long to see the beloved 'n'ata vota' (one more time) highlight the depth of his yearning. The song captures the essence of unfulfilled love, where the absence of the beloved is felt more acutely in the stillness of the night. The calmness of the mountain and the sleeping world around him only amplify his sense of isolation and heartache, making 'Tu Ca Nun Chiagne' a timeless exploration of human emotion and the pain of longing.
